Output 89af25f3f0cfb1bfde76b95d707361eaf93a2b39bf9d3e0aa33e76adbda3d58a:10

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 b13a3e15ce0633556242969b388b95c574e82d4e
address
tb1qkyaru9wwqce42cjzj6dn3zu4c46wst2wsyl4dn
transaction
89af25f3f0cfb1bfde76b95d707361eaf93a2b39bf9d3e0aa33e76adbda3d58a
confirmations
13593
spent
true